Question

the structure below is a __________ amine.

select the correct answer below:

primary (1°)

secondary (2°)

tertiary (3°)

none of the above

Explanation:

Step1: Recall amine classification rules

A primary amine ($1^{\circ}$) has one alkyl group attached to the nitrogen atom. A secondary amine ($2^{\circ}$) has two alkyl groups attached to the nitrogen atom. A tertiary amine ($3^{\circ}$) has three alkyl groups attached to the nitrogen atom.

Step2: Analyze the given structure

In the structure $\mathrm{CH_3 - CH(NH_2)-CH_3}$, the nitrogen atom of the $\mathrm{-NH_2}$ group is attached to one carbon (the $\mathrm{CH}$ carbon which is part of the alkyl group in the context of amine classification). So, it has one alkyl group attached to the nitrogen atom.

Answer:

primary (1°)
